- SynopsisFuturistic action adventure. In a future earth where the landscape has been reduced to barren desert, civilization has broken down. A ruling ruthless warlord, Immortan Joe, who is hoarding the supply of water sends his best driver, Furiosa, on the latest mission to bring back a huge supply of petrol from a distant town (her lorry to be accompanied by assorted other vehicles, for security). Furiosa takes an unscheduled left turn, however, and heads out east across the desert. Her detour enrages Immortan Joe and he sends his forces to stop her. A long chase ensues, in which Furiosa and her secret cargo (of the warlord's unwilling brides) help and are helped by Max, a slave of Immortan Joe who is kept only for his supply of fresh blood. The warlord himself sets out to put an end to the challenge to his empire posed by this alliance of determined rebels. (Synopsis)
- Work historyFilming note: Filmed in Namibia and at the Cape Town film studios, South Africa on location and at Fox Studios Sydney, Australia.
